Wired Gigabit to my Sony TV!
Works to add gigabit Ethernet connection to my Sony a80k. I prefer to have as much wired in my house to keep wireless traffic to a minimum. This adapter allows the TV to connect faster to streaming providers and better performance with my local files. Definitely worth a try if you want a faster wired connection for your TV. Perfect for Onn 4k Pro
I purchased this to use with an ONN 4K Pro GoogleTV streaming device. That streamer has a 100mbps ethernet port but this dongle gives me 900mbps+ when connected to my TP-Link Deco AXE5400 wifi 6e mesh pod. Literally plug-n-play, immediately recognized by device with zero problems. Compatibility:Onn 4k pro Works well:Handles fast speed Reliability:Seamless and reliable

Confirming it works with Hisense U8N.
Just wanted to confirm for others that this adapter model 202013-BLK works flawlessly with my Hisense 85" U8N. Super easy installation too. All I did was turn off the WiFi, then plugged in the adapter into the USB 3.0 port (this tv also has another USB 2.0 port), and then plugged in the ethernet cable and it instantly started working! Before I tried this one, I tried the Amazon Basics Aluminum ethernet adapter and it did not work in my Hisense U8N or my Amazon Fire TV Omni Series, but thus Cable Matters Adapter model 202013-BLK works great and hardly costs anything. Build quality seems just fine. I would definitely buy another one if a need for a second one arises.

For now, it saved me from buying a new laptop
My problem was that the Network Card in my laptop has only 100MBps of speed (and is integrated into the MB), so no way to install a new one -as far as I learnt from research. So, even if my Xfinity internet plan provides a 300MBps speed, I would constantly get cut off and get messages like "ERR_NETWORK_CHANGED" and such (I do have to say that this didn't happen when on Fiber Optic but it became too expensive for my budget). The test for speed (Download & Upload) would give no more than 90 and 23 respectively (23 of Upload is in line with my plan) but 90 Download was the problem -to me anyway. So, I purchase this Gigabyte Ethernet Adapter and test runs now come up to 180-285 of Download -depending on the time of the day. The "error messages" have stopped and the cutting off when on Skype are down considerably. I still have a machine that's 7 years old, so I'll be shopping for a new one when things gets slower again but for now, this gizmo is buying me some time

Confirmed: Realtek RTL8153 Chipset
Tested Device(s):Linux Laptop (Fedora Xfce Spin) : YesNintendo Switch: NO. Does not work with the Switch, as the advertising suggests, but I thought I was try it and let people know here in this review.Detected Chipset:Realtek RTL8153, confirmed via lsusb on LinuxDriver Behavior:Linux: Plug-and-play, no manual driver installation requiredWindows 11: Didn’t test, although I am sure it works fine.macOS: Didn’t testPerformance:Achieved expected speeds (up to 1 Gbps), confirmed with ethtoolNotes:Detected by Linux as RTL8153 (ID 0bda:8153 Realtek Semiconductor Corp.)Suitable for Raspberry Pi, Linux laptops, and possibly Steam Deck (not tested)Final Verdict:If you're looking for a reliable USB Ethernet adapter with full Linux compatibility, this Cable Matters model using the Realtek RTL8153 chipset is a solid pick. Just be aware that not all Cable Matters adapters use the same chipset—this one does.

Works with Sony 65X90J NOT Bravia 7!!!
Works great on Sony 65X90J. No issues. Plug and play. However, it does not work on a Bravia 7 (85XR70). When plugged in it delivers fast Ethernet connection, but after a few days I had to hard reset the TV as it wouldn't turn on the with the remote. I would unplug the TV wait 10 seconds plug back in and it would work. So there is something wrong with the adapter or USB 3.0 on the Bravia 7. After disconnecting the adapter the TV has been fine. So if you have a Bravia 7, this will not work for you.
